Tourism heroes have scooped prestigious awards at glitzy Oscars-style ceremony held at Chatsworth.
Winners of the Visit Peak District and Derbyshire's Excel Tourism Awards included the Dowager Duchess of Devonshire who received a Lifetime Achievement Award. Charlotte Spivey of The Maynard in Grindleford picked up Young Manager of the Year.

Volunteer of the Year was presented to Alan Barber of Crich Tramway Village. Team of the Year went to Gullivers Kingdom in Matlock Bath and Unsung Hero was presented to Brian Gammon of East Lodge in Rowsley.
